What it does
JointPal.ai is an innovative platform designed to ease arthritis and joint pain management through a personalized AI-driven experience. The platform features a chatbot that interacts with users to identify specific areas of discomfort and recommends targeted stretches and exercises. With a comprehensive library of visual guides and detailed instructions, users can engage in stretches suited to their mobility levels. JointPal.ai adapts to individual progress over time, providing tailored recommendations and strategies for effective joint health management.
How we built it
The development of JointPal.ai was a collaborative effort that combined various technologies. We utilized OpenAI's API for advanced text processing and conversational interactions. The front end was built with React.js, ensuring a dynamic and responsive user experience. Axios was implemented for efficient communication between the front end and our Node.js back end, which was chosen for its scalability and ability to handle asynchronous events. This tech stack allowed us to create a user-friendly platform that meets the needs of our target audience.
Challenges we ran into
Throughout the project, we faced several challenges. One major hurdle was ensuring the AI accurately interpreted user symptoms and provided appropriate recommendations. Striking a balance between technical accuracy and user engagement was crucial. We also encountered difficulties with integrating the chatbot seamlessly into the user interface, necessitating numerous iterations to refine its responses and ensure clarity and relevance. Additionally, managing our time effectively during the HackCamp to meet deadlines while maintaining quality was a constant challenge.
